Re: [OTTD] The Vactrain Set
The 750km/h limit was put there to try and prevent abuse of the vactrain-maglev compatibility by being able to run vactrains from older versions of the set at vactrain speeds on the much cheaper maglev track. However when I get around to updating this set, I'll include a parameterCryolaser wrote:Given the release of FRIMS with trains capable of going faster than 750kmh, would you be willing and able to raise or remove the limit on the compatibility maglev track replacement in the Vactrain Set?
